Position Summary:
The Medical Director (MD) is the principal internal therapeutic expert who provides scientific expertise to support client needs assessment and content development. The MD serves as the primary quality control contact for internal teams and external clients, and coordinates the content development efforts of external faculty, Key Opinion Leader (KOL) and internal writing and editorial staffs. The MD works on multiple programs simultaneously and leads each team from a standpoint of content strategy and development.
Specific Responsibilities:
- Responsible for the scientific direction of client programs. Ensures that medical communications are accurate, clinically relevant, and reflect the most recent medical advances.
- Consult with key opinion leaders and subject matter experts. Provides expert resources and information as needed.
- Work with clients to define goals and objectives of communication programs, ensuring delivery of the highest quality product.
- Participate in strategic planning and business development programs in their therapeutic areas of responsibility.
- Remain current with medical developments and search the research literature to ensure delivery of accurate content.
- Summarize clinical trial data and translate relevance for the appropriate target audiences according to client requirements for their current projects and their future areas of business development.
- Write medical documents including but not limited to manuscripts, white papers, monographs, slide kits, and training modules.
- Edit medical documents, review written copy for scientific and strategic accuracy, and provide quality control when necessary.
- Provide scientific and strategic background to writers, editors and other staff members.
- Manage in-house, Bangalore, and outsourced content development and editing resources assigned to a project.
- Work with the Creative Team (medical Illustrators, animators, and graphic artists) to plan the delivery of visual assets in learning products.
- Develop content outlines for proposals as assigned and attend client presentations or pitches as needed.
- Establish a strategic partner relationship with clients for development and implementation of client programs.
- Develop a strong working relationship with client medical teams to facilitate information flow and the development of new ideas.
- Take ownership for all content deliverables for all assignments
- Be a visible presence in client relationships
